ANGEL

EDUARDO

The pictorial practice of Angel Eduardo is articulated around the body as a symbolic and vulnerable territory, traversed by memory, time, and transformation.

His works do not function as literal portraits or narratives, but as fragmented presences in which matter, drawing, and stain construct a language of their own. The body appears eroded, incomplete, subjected to tensions between control and accident, between permanence and dissolution.

Through elements displaced from their original function — everyday objects, ritual gestures, anatomical fragments — the painting builds metaphors charged with emotional, spiritual, and historical weight. The use of gold does not act as ornament, but as a sign of threshold: that which persists, that which aches, or that which remains inscribed in human experience.

Each work proposes a space of projection in which the viewer recognizes their own emotional traces. The painting does not illustrate a prior idea; it embodies it.
